Westminster City Council acting for the Cross River Partnership (CRP)'s London boroughs of Camden, City of London, Islington, Kensington & Chelsea, Lambeth, Southwark and the London boroughs of Hammersmith & Fulham, Lewisham, and Wandsworth. CRP has been successful in gaining funding from the London European Regional Development Fund 5 (ERDF5) for the delivery of a local procurement support initially, 'Supply Cross River 2 - Developing Supply Chains in Central London' (SXR2). SRX2 will work towards widening access to procurement and supply chain opportunities for small and medium sized businesses (SME) in the 10 London boroughs listed above.
